Problem with the main menu
Author: Vlad L.I noticed a strange problem, i've been getting complaints from users that they cant acces the main menu from my site (www.medicalexpert.ro) : they can see it, but hovering over it doesnt open any submenus. At first I had no idea what was happening, supposing that it just didn't finished loading -and seeming that switching from the main page to something else, like "contact" and clicking back on "acasa" (home) made everything work as it should- decided to ignore it. The thing is that the problem still persists and after looking at it more carefully I noticed that my "main" page, the one that can be accessed from google points to www.medicalexpert.ro INSTEAD, the one that is shown in X5 editor's preview, and the one that actually has the menu working (after switching the pages around as mentioned above) is www.medicalexpert.ro/acasa.html; and there is the problem. How can I fix this ?
Hello Vlad,
I see your problem and understand what you are saying.
The two pages in question have been produced using different versions of the X5 software: one with version 10.1.8.52 and one with the current version 10.1.12.57
It looks like some sort of file corruption has occurred as a result of this.
I would suggest in the first instance doing a full refresh of the existing files on your web server. In other words, delete all X5 files from the server, and publish to the web anew, using the option in Step 5 to transfer ALL files, not just those changed recently.
Let us know if the problem still persists having done that.
Kind regards,
Paul
Author
I did just that before asking here, but encountered a strange problem : 404.
Even if the files were there, accessing the site was impossible... (i am using Cpanel if it matters)
Any advice ?
Author
Why is x5 making this ? It's not like I was using a 5 y/o version of the program, 10.1.8.52 and 10.1.12.57 are very cloose to one another, you'd expect nothing to go wrong from just a simple update...
Hello Vlad,
In this instance I genuinely don't feel WebSite X5 is causing your issue. I think your issue is due to corrupt files on the server, uploading to the wrong folder on the server, or server misconfiguration.
Your statement that you got a 404 error further strengthens my belief that this is the case.
Can you check please that all old files are deleted from you server completely, and can you then confirm that the 'Destination folder' in Step 5 of WebSite X5 under 'Optional parameters' is set to reflect the root folder of your project on the server... i.e. the one in which acasa.html should be uploaded to?
Kind regards,
Paul
Author
This is what i did:
1. opened public_html/medicalexpert.ro (the folder where i've been uploading the site for over a year now)
2. copyed everything somewhere else (for backup) and then delete everything in this folder
3. let x5 re-upload the files, in the same folder
After that I checked the contents and everything was in order (close to the size of the "old" version, same folder architecture and contents) but now if i go to the web adress, i get 404.
Is there a setting that points to the main page of the site which now may be pointing to soomething else ?
It appears to now be working correctly. Uploading anew has cured it.
If you cannot see the changes in your own browser, try emptying the cache or pressing F5 on your keyboard to refresh the page.
Kind regards,
Paul
You could also check whether your server is employing a process whereby the "uptime" is increased.
I can't remember what it's called but it can result in massive corruptions of an "edit and publish".
It's to do with the server cache when it does its backup.
I had it switched off!
Best wishes,
Nigel
Author
Fixed it, it was a problem with the server, after redoing the above procedure, now it actually worked, it was strange tough, same files, same place, different result :) Thanks anyway